Q: Is 4,016,116 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,016,116 is a composite number.

Why is 4,016,116 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,016,116 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 13 26 52 169 338 457 676 914 1,828 2,197 4,394 5,941 8,788 11,882 23,764 77,233 154,466 308,932 1,004,029 2,008,058 and 4,016,116, with no remainder.

Since 4,016,116 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,016,116, it is a composite number.
